Ryanair Unfiltered: Growth, Distribution and the Business Travel Ecosystem

An exclusive chance to hear from Ryanair and their plans to support the business travel sector. ITM’s CEO sits down with Ryanair’s Distribution Partnerships Manager Ed Gogic to discuss the airlines evolving role in the business travel ecosystem.


The discussion will lift the lid on how Ryanair is engaging with the industry, addressing long-standing perceptions while responding to the practical needs of the business traveller and intermediaries. With a focus on transparency and real-world delivery, the conversation will cover Ryanair’s approach to Travel Agent Direct (TAD), recent developments in its GDS strategy, and what improved serviceability through TMCs means in practice.

Decisions, Not Dashboards: Data That Actually Delivers Value

In business travel, time has become the scarcest resource for both buyers and suppliers. Policies, sustainability targets, cost pressure and duty of care are all intensifying - yet the data that should help often slows everyone down. Reports are noisy, dashboards are crowded, and insights rarely reach the people who must act on them.


In this session, Dan Raine from Unlocked Data shows how buyers and suppliers can turn Travel & Expense data into a shared language that speeds up decisions, strengthens partnerships and delivers measurable results across travel programmes and supplier portfolios. Moving beyond “reporting”, he will explore the art of storytelling with data: what to show, what to leave out, and how to frame insights so they drive action. Attendees will leave with simple, practical techniques they can apply immediately to make their data clearer, more trusted and more impactful.
